Staples-Motley High School renovation and expansion

Through a transformative partnership with Lakewood Health Systems, the Staples Motley High School renovation and expansion addressed a century-old facility’s outdated infrastructure and a local shortage of recreation space. By adopting an Academic-Modern aesthetic that utilizes durable precast concrete to contrast with the historic brick masonry, the design successfully integrated a modern community wellness hub onto a constrained site while maintaining high-level school security through a strategic upper-level layout. The project’s centerpiece is an innovative walking track that threads through existing walls and over roof spaces to provide exercise areas and balcony viewing for the expanded 800-seat varsity gymnasium, which now supports three-mat wrestling competitions and features a 24-foot digital display. The space welcomes you with environmental graphics from the cardinal mascot to encouraging phrases painted on the walls. This game-changing development upgraded district-wide air quality systems and relocated the weight room from an inaccessible third floor to a high-performance environment, simultaneously improving student-athlete performance and community health.
